What is Oyster Knife?

An oyster knife is basically the tool that you use to suck or open oysters with. A good knife has a short dull blade with a flat pointed tip that can easily penetrate the shell and rounded enough at the tip not to puncture the oyster.

It is usually advised to use a glove or kitchen towel to improve the grip on an oyster in order to prevent slipping when opening the shell.

What Features To Look For When Choosing a Knife For Oyster?

Here are a few tips on what to look for in a good Knife;

Blade

The Blade does not need to be sharp on either of the edges but should be a bit narrower and narrows down to a round point.

The most important aspect of the blade is that it is durable, normally made from stainless steel as well as corrosion resistant as oysters contain plenty of salt.

The Blade also needs to be short in order to handle more pressure as a longer blade might snap with excessive force.

The Tip

The Tip of the knife needs to be upturned also called a New Haven tip which makes it easier to work the hinge and pry open the shell without damaging the meat.

Professional shuckers and canneries use straight or Boston tip knives because they do not mind damaging the meat as the meat is cooked and canned. So the tip style will depend on the speed or finesse that you would want to use when shucking your oysters.

Handle

Most likely the most important part of the oyster knife is the handle.

The handle must be big enough with an ergonomic design to provide the best grip used with mesh gloves as well as sturdy enough to handle the pressure exerted on it.

Weight

Because you may be shucking oysters for hours at a time it is wise to have a lightweight knife for oyster that will prevent hand fatigue and is easy to use.
